Nitric acid phenylmercury(II) salt - Physico-chemical Properties

Molecular FormulaC6H5HgNO3
Molar Mass339.7
Melting Point188-190℃ (decomposition)
Water Solubility<0.1 g/100 mL at 22 C
Solubility Very slightly soluble in water and in ethanol (96 per cent), slightly soluble in hot water. It dissolves in glycerol and in fatty oils.
Appearancesolid
StabilityStable.

Nitric acid phenylmercury(II) salt - Reference Information

EPA chemical information Information provided by: ofmpub.epa.gov (external link)
category toxic substances
toxicity classification highly toxic
acute toxicity subcutaneous-rat LD50: 63 mg/kg
flammability hazard characteristics thermal decomposition of highly toxic mercury vapor
storage and transportation characteristics warehouse ventilation and low temperature drying; Separate storage and transportation from acids, oxidants and food
fire extinguishing agent water, sand, foam
occupational standard TLV-TWA 0.1 mg (mercury)/m3; STEL 0.15 mg (mercury)/m3
